public static void RestoreDockPanel(DockPanel dockPanel, XmlTextReader xmlIn, DockPanelExt.DeserializeDockContentDelegate deserializeDockContent) { if (xmlIn.Name != "DockPanel") { throw new ArgumentException("Invalid Xml Format"); } var dockPanelStruct = new DockPanelStruct(); dockPanelStruct.DockLeftPortion = Convert.ToDouble(xmlIn.GetAttribute("DockLeftPortion"), CultureInfo.InvariantCulture); dockPanelStruct.DockRightPortion = Convert.ToDouble(xmlIn.GetAttribute("DockRightPortion"), CultureInfo.InvariantCulture); dockPanelStruct.DockTopPortion = Convert.ToDouble(xmlIn.GetAttribute("DockTopPortion"), CultureInfo.InvariantCulture); dockPanelStruct.DockBottomPortion = Convert.ToDouble(xmlIn.GetAttribute("DockBottomPortion"), CultureInfo.InvariantCulture); dockPanelStruct.IndexActiveDocumentPane = Convert.ToInt32(xmlIn.GetAttribute("ActiveDocumentPane"), CultureInfo.InvariantCulture); dockPanelStruct.IndexActivePane = Convert.ToInt32(xmlIn.GetAttribute("ActivePane"), CultureInfo.InvariantCulture); // Load Contents MoveToNextElement(xmlIn); if (xmlIn.Name != "Contents") { throw new ArgumentException("Invalid Xml Format"); } ContentStruct[] contents = LoadAndCreateContents(dockPanel, xmlIn, deserializeDockContent); // Load Panes MoveToNextElement(xmlIn); if (xmlIn.Name != "Panes") { throw new ArgumentException("Invalid Xml Format"); } PaneStruct[] panes = LoadPanes(xmlIn); // Load DockWindows MoveToNextElement(xmlIn); if (xmlIn.Name != "DockWindows") { throw new ArgumentException("Invalid Xml Format"); } DockWindowStruct[] dockWindows = LoadDockWindows(xmlIn, dockPanel); // Load FloatWindows MoveToNextElement(xmlIn); if (xmlIn.Name != "FloatWindows") { throw new ArgumentException("Invalid Xml Format"); } FloatWindowStruct[] floatWindows = LoadFloatWindows(xmlIn); dockPanel.SuspendLayout(true); dockPanel.DockLeftPortion = dockPanelStruct.DockLeftPortion; dockPanel.DockRightPortion = dockPanelStruct.DockRightPortion; dockPanel.DockTopPortion = dockPanelStruct.DockTopPortion; dockPanel.DockBottomPortion = dockPanelStruct.DockBottomPortion; // Set DockWindow ZOrders int prevMaxDockWindowZOrder = int.MaxValue; for (int i = 0; i < dockWindows.Length; i++) { int maxDockWindowZOrder = -1; int index = -1; for (int j = 0; j < dockWindows.Length; j++) { if (dockWindows[j].ZOrderIndex > maxDockWindowZOrder && dockWindows[j].ZOrderIndex < prevMaxDockWindowZOrder) { maxDockWindowZOrder = dockWindows[j].ZOrderIndex; index = j; } } dockPanel.DockWindows[dockWindows[index].DockState].BringToFront(); prevMaxDockWindowZOrder = maxDockWindowZOrder; } // Create panes foreach (PaneStruct t in panes) { DockPane pane = null; for (int j = 0; j < t.IndexContents.Length; j++) { IDockContent content = dockPanel.Contents[t.IndexContents[j]]; if (j == 0) { pane = dockPanel.DockPaneFactory.CreateDockPane(content, t.DockState, false); } else if (t.DockState == DockState.Float) { content.DockHandler.FloatPane = pane; } else { content.DockHandler.PanelPane = pane; } } } // Assign Panes to DockWindows foreach (DockWindowStruct t in dockWindows) { for (int j = 0; j < t.NestedPanes.Length; j++) { DockWindow dw = dockPanel.DockWindows[t.DockState]; int indexPane = t.NestedPanes[j].IndexPane; DockPane pane = dockPanel.Panes[indexPane]; int indexPrevPane = t.NestedPanes[j].IndexPrevPane; DockPane prevPane = (indexPrevPane == -1) ? dw.NestedPanes.GetDefaultPreviousPane(pane) : dockPanel.Panes[indexPrevPane]; DockAlignment alignment = t.NestedPanes[j].Alignment; double proportion = t.NestedPanes[j].Proportion; pane.DockTo(dw, prevPane, alignment, proportion); if (panes[indexPane].DockState == dw.DockState) { panes[indexPane].ZOrderIndex = t.ZOrderIndex; } } } // Create float windows foreach (FloatWindowStruct t in floatWindows) { FloatWindow fw = null; for (int j = 0; j < t.NestedPanes.Length; j++) { int indexPane = t.NestedPanes[j].IndexPane; DockPane pane = dockPanel.Panes[indexPane]; if (j == 0) { fw = dockPanel.FloatWindowFactory.CreateFloatWindow(dockPanel, pane, t.Bounds); } else { int indexPrevPane = t.NestedPanes[j].IndexPrevPane; DockPane prevPane = indexPrevPane == -1 ? null : dockPanel.Panes[indexPrevPane]; DockAlignment alignment = t.NestedPanes[j].Alignment; double proportion = t.NestedPanes[j].Proportion; pane.DockTo(fw, prevPane, alignment, proportion); } if (panes[indexPane].DockState == fw.DockState) { panes[indexPane].ZOrderIndex = t.ZOrderIndex; } } } // sort IDockContent by its Pane's ZOrder int[] sortedContents = null; if (contents.Length > 0) { sortedContents = new int[contents.Length]; for (int i = 0; i < contents.Length; i++) { sortedContents[i] = i; } int lastDocument = contents.Length; for (int i = 0; i < contents.Length - 1; i++) { for (int j = i + 1; j < contents.Length; j++) { DockPane pane1 = dockPanel.Contents[sortedContents[i]].DockHandler.Pane; int ZOrderIndex1 = pane1 == null ? 0 : panes[dockPanel.Panes.IndexOf(pane1)].ZOrderIndex; DockPane pane2 = dockPanel.Contents[sortedContents[j]].DockHandler.Pane; int ZOrderIndex2 = pane2 == null ? 0 : panes[dockPanel.Panes.IndexOf(pane2)].ZOrderIndex; if (ZOrderIndex1 > ZOrderIndex2) { int temp = sortedContents[i]; sortedContents[i] = sortedContents[j]; sortedContents[j] = temp; } } } } // show non-document IDockContent first to avoid screen flickers for (int i = 0; i < contents.Length; i++) { IDockContent content = dockPanel.Contents[sortedContents[i]]; if (content.DockHandler.Pane != null && content.DockHandler.Pane.DockState != DockState.Document) { content.DockHandler.IsHidden = contents[sortedContents[i]].IsHidden; } } // after all non-document IDockContent, show document IDockContent for (int i = 0; i < contents.Length; i++) { IDockContent content = dockPanel.Contents[sortedContents[i]]; if (content.DockHandler.Pane != null && content.DockHandler.Pane.DockState == DockState.Document) { content.DockHandler.IsHidden = contents[sortedContents[i]].IsHidden; } } for (int i = 0; i < panes.Length; i++) { dockPanel.Panes[i].ActiveContent = panes[i].IndexActiveContent == -1 ? null : dockPanel.Contents[panes[i].IndexActiveContent]; } if (dockPanelStruct.IndexActiveDocumentPane != -1) { dockPanel.Panes[dockPanelStruct.IndexActiveDocumentPane].Activate(); } if (dockPanelStruct.IndexActivePane != -1) { dockPanel.Panes[dockPanelStruct.IndexActivePane].Activate(); } for (int i = dockPanel.Contents.Count - 1; i >= 0; i--) { if (dockPanel.Contents[i] is DummyContent) { dockPanel.Contents[i].DockHandler.Form.Close(); } } dockPanel.ResumeLayout(true, true); }
